Gers Suffer SWPL Defeat From Late Penalty

AN injury time penalty saw Rangers lose their first game of the SWPL season this afternoon.

Summer Green’s 92nd minute spot-kick secured all three points for Celtic, despite the Gers dominating large spells of the match.

Malky Thomson named one change to the side from last weekend’s victory over Hibs with Brogan Hay coming into the starting eleven and Daina Bourma on the bench.

Rangers had a number of corners in the opening stages of the game, but weren’t able to test Chloe Logan in the Celtic goal.

Jenna Fife was called into action on the 9th minute as Summer Green’s curling effort was pushed over the bar by the Gers number one, before Natalie Ross saw her shot go just over shortly after.

On the 31st minute Nicola Docherty had a shot for Rangers as a clearance from Celtic fell to the left-back on the edge of the box. She hit it first time, but the effort was wide of the target.

Rangers had a great chance on the 35th minute as a lovely pass from Lizzie Arnot picked out Zoe Ness who raced towards goal but her shot was held comfortably by Chloe Logan.

Malky Thomson’s side came close to breaking the deadlock just a few minutes later as Brogan Hay delivered a dangerous cross into the box. Zoe Ness laid the ball off to captain Clare Gemmell but her shot was cleared off the line by Celtic.

The visitors threatened from the kick-off as Sarah Ewens shot was just inches over the crossbar.

Chloe Logan denied Rangers the opener on the 50th minute as a free-kick swung in the box was chested down by Zoe Ness to Chelsea Cornet. The midfielder fired a powerful strike towards goal but the Celtic keeper got enough on the ball to tip it over the bar.

As both teams searched for a breakthrough Sarah Ewans saw her shot go just wide of the target before Zoe Ness picked out Daina Bourma but her shot was saved by Chloe Logan.

Jenna Fife made two terrific saves for Rangers in the space of 30 seconds with 20 minutes of the game remaining. First the Gers keeper denied Lisa Robertson from a free-kick, before doing well to get a hand on Caitlin Hayes’ header from the resulting corner.

Rangers were pressing for a break through as Demi Vance’s shot spun just wide of the target.

Celtic were awarded a penalty in the 92nd minute for a handball in the Rangers box. Summer Green stepped up to the spot and sent the ball beyond Jenna Fife.
